What’s salvaging ?

It’s a way to quickly make money in Wasteland to allow you to gear up at the Gun Stores.

What salvaging involves is claiming back the burnt wrecks of vehicles, these can be Quads, Hatchbacks, SUV’s, Off Roads, Wagons and any of the Armoured Vehicles and Helicopters, so as long as they’ve burned, they can then be reclaimed.

The money you get back for salvaging depends on the vehicle, this is usually anything from about $140 for a Quad, right up to about $1500 for a Helicopter.

Easiest way to get some vehicles to salvage is to destroy them yourself, if you have an RPG or any explosive satchels, it’s just a case of parking a load of vehicles together and setting off the charge or firing the RPG at them, be sure to stood well back though as when those vehicles blow they spew out a ton of shrapnel and heat, all of which can either kill you or seriously injure you.

Another way to destroy a ton of vehicles if you don’t have the RPG or Satchel Charge, is to again park all the vehicles close to each other and then place a Quad as close as possible to them, then using max of 3 clips of ammo you can shoot up the Quad tires first then the fuel tank on it, this should cause it to explode, which then causes a chain reaction and everything else goes up, now you’ve got yourself not just a quad to salvage but all the vehicles that were beside it.

Now that you’ve blown them up, you need to salvage them, here’s another tip, make sure before you blow them, you have a Repair Kit in your Inventory, as this will speed up the act of Salvaging the vehicles, which if your near to spawn points is a must, as nothing attracts other players to a site more than smoke from burning wrecks . .

When salvaging be sure to keep a good distance from the burning wrecks, as excess heat will cause injury or death to you, also try to blow them up near vegetation/buildings, as you can use these as cover when salvaging, as nothing worse than being killed by the enemy because your sat out in the open reclaiming, they get all your hard-earned salvage 🙁

It’s also a good idea to make sure that you leave at least one vehicle out of the explosion and away from it, as this will be your escape means for when anyone turns up during the salvaging, you can also use it to store any nice things you may have found in the quads/cars/off-road/wagons before you blow them up.

Something else to take note of is that if after you’ve up all the vehicles up in the town and new one’s spawn, that’s a major hint that someone else has just spawned into the town, as both Vehicles and loot re-spawn when people spawn into the towns, so watch out.

  1. Pro tip: Instead of ‘investing’ the cost of a RPG rocket or a satchel in order to destroy some vehicles: Place any base part (ideally a wall or block) into a vehicle of your choice. Any vehicle works. Then get some distance and fire a single pistol shot at the vehicle. The hit will cause some physics logic to be executed and consequently, since we now have an object sharing the same space as the vehicle, lead to a bombastic explosion.
